Generic answer - yes, you can. Exactly the same way as you would do it on real hardware machine. Boot loader is not a part of Bochs anyway. -----Original Message----- From: Marcus Szanto [mailto:[email protected]] Sent: Tuesday, October 16, 2012 5:12 PM To: [email protected] Subject: [Bochs-developers] Changing boot loader in Bochs?
